Transaction 320a6bfaac316fc20c5a80c496f1156c484c7ab6db7ae7c036ef7958756480e2

1 Input
2 Outputs
  • 320a6bfaac316fc20c5a80c496f1156c484c7ab6db7ae7c036ef7958756480e2:0
  • value  10477000
    address  32XjSn4jWw1PW2raFNDTWzaHc4VE29mZcX
  • 320a6bfaac316fc20c5a80c496f1156c484c7ab6db7ae7c036ef7958756480e2:1
  • value  28584227
    address  33XThT1EZmUTpcRkofF16JAzF344Qji1Df